Communications Sector Braces for 2025-26 Weather Risks

Exercise Disconnect & Reconnect, facilitated by the National Emergency Management Agency (NEMA), was aimed at strengthening emergency response to telecommunications outages - including impacts on the Triple Zero network - by identifying gaps, testing coordination, assessing alternatives, and addressing impacts and restoration barriers.

NEMA put participants through their paces, 'war gaming' a set of catastrophic and nationally significant scenarios based on the projected forecast for the HRWS.

Undertaking exercises like this ensures all stakeholders are working together and are prepared for a range of scenarios before Australia enters the HRWS in earnest.

The department will use observations and learnings from Exercise Disconnect & Reconnect to identify priority actions for industry and government, and to inform future policy, planning and capability development efforts.
